Because I’m always on the run and carrying the kids in and out of the car, I usually opt for office wear that are comfy and breathable. In the fall, that means layering with stretchy pieces, walkable boots, and topping them off with fluffy things.

IMG_0896 kevkolo2r

Tuesday’s office attire included a high bun (almost always), a stretchy cotton dress, fleece leggings, cap-sleeve faux fur vest, knee-high boots, loads of accessories, and as always – finish off with an oversized bag.
